是否可以在不添加状态栏的情况下在表单上提供调整大小指示(resizer-grip)?

时间:2009-10-14 12:54:54

标签: c# winforms user-interface

我想在Windows窗体表单上显示调整大小指示(与状态栏相同的resize-grip)。 我不想在表单中添加状态栏 - 这会破坏表单的设计。

表单内部可以有各种控件(Fill)。 除了在每个控件的右下角绘制调整大小指示之外,我还没有找到任何解决方案,这是不可行的。

如果没有为每个可以停靠在表单中的控件添加调整大小手柄的图片,这是否可行?

1 个答案:

答案 0 :(得分:14)

您无需使用状态栏来调整手柄大小。

设置SizeGripStyle属性,然后调整from或控件的填充,该控件位于表单的右下角,这样控件就不会在尺寸调整手柄上绘制。

form.SizeGripStyle = System.Windows.Forms.SizeGripStyle.Show;

Screenshot